How will THEMIS 5.0 effectively communicate, disseminate, and exploit its research and findings?

Writer's picture: THEMIS 5.0THEMIS 5.0

Today, we will discuss how THEMIS 5.0 intends to reach out to the public, and spread its research and findings through:


  • Communication

  • Dissemination

  • Exploitation


Communication

Communication is how we work to promote THEMIS 5.0 to as wide a range of audiences as possible, both in the media and the general public. With the aim being to engage with the whole of society while also specifically focusing on particular audiences whose experiences, especially with Artificial Intelligence, intersect with the research of THEMIS 5.0. Additionally, the role of communication in the THEMIS 5.0 project is to demonstrate how EU funding is working towards tackling major societal challenges.


Dissemination

Dissemination is the publicization of project results to a wider audience through a range of mediums (such as this blog). The purpose of this is to ensure that results from the THEMIS 5.0 project are readily available and digestible, so that they may be widely known by relevant individuals and groups (whether that be the scientific community, public sector, commercial actors, professional organisations, policymakers) who can then employ our research into their own work. 


Exploitation

Exploitation is the employment of the research and results during and following the end of THEMIS 5.0. This would not only be for commercial uses, but also the social benefit that can be derived from better policy formation, and the general tackling of important economic and social problems that may arise from AI.
